The unknown resistance is approximately 0.44 Ω.

Solution:

Total (equivalent) resistance = 0.28 Ω

Resistance 1 = ?

Resistance 2 = 0.81 Ω

To find the unknown resistance.

Formula for determining equivalent resistance in a parallel circuit:


$(1)/(R_(e q))=(1)/(R_(1))+(1)/(R_(2))

Substitute the given values in the formula.


$(1)/(0.28)=(1)/(R_(1))+(1)/(0.81)


$3.571=(1)/(R_(1))+1.235

Subtract 1.235 on both sides of the equation, we get


$2.282=(1)/(R_(1))

Take reciprocal to find
R_1.


$R_(1)=(1)/(2.282)


$R_(1)=0.44


R_1 = 0.44 Ω

The unknown resistance is approximately 0.44 Ω.
